mirror of
https://github.com/bggRGjQaUbCoE/PiliPlus.git
synced 2026-06-01 16:48:16 +08:00
fix progress behavior
Signed-off-by: dom <githubaccount56556@proton.me>
This commit is contained in:
@@ -1740,10 +1740,13 @@ class _PLVideoPlayerState extends State<PLVideoPlayer>
|
|||||||
right: 0,
|
right: 0,
|
||||||
child: Obx(
|
child: Obx(
|
||||||
() {
|
() {
|
||||||
|
final showControls = plPlayerController.showControls.value;
|
||||||
final offstage = switch (plPlayerController.progressType) {
|
final offstage = switch (plPlayerController.progressType) {
|
||||||
BtmProgressBehavior.onlyShowFullScreen => !isFullScreen,
|
BtmProgressBehavior.onlyShowFullScreen =>
|
||||||
BtmProgressBehavior.onlyHideFullScreen => isFullScreen,
|
showControls || !isFullScreen,
|
||||||
_ => plPlayerController.showControls.value,
|
BtmProgressBehavior.onlyHideFullScreen =>
|
||||||
|
showControls || isFullScreen,
|
||||||
|
_ => showControls,
|
||||||
};
|
};
|
||||||
return Offstage(
|
return Offstage(
|
||||||
offstage: offstage,
|
offstage: offstage,
|
||||||
|
|||||||
Reference in New Issue
Block a user